Pros

Great employee discount Well recognized company Opportunity to transfer to different locations (including international) 401k plan/vacation/health benefits for full time employees Good training tools Reimburses tuition depending on the classes taken Opportunity for monthly bonuses No commission

Cons

Most times hourly pay is not enough to pay rent for an adult living alone. Work/life balance leaves something to be desired. Whether you're promoted often depends on how your store manager feels about you. They can either help you go far, or keep you under their thumb. Reaching out to higher ups is often discouraged. Company seems to demand more growth while making decisions that will negatively affect the growth they're asking you to achieve. No commission.

Pros

-A well known brand that definitely is a good addition to your resume

Cons

-Compensation is terrible. I am not sure if anyone took into account the cost of living in NYC. I could have moved out of the city I suppose but if I commuted I wouldn't have been able to put in the 18 hour work days that were required -No work life balance. Don't ask for vacation ever. -Management and leadership are lacking. -Turnover is high. Probably from some of the above things I have mentioned. -Organization and communication between departments needs to be regulated. It seems like it's "every man for himself" mentality. -Promotions and advancements are few are far between. And when I say far between I mean years, regardless of your experience.
